WebThe Isle of Gigha (pronounced "geea") is some seven miles long and about a mile and a half wide.It is aligned with the west coast of the north end of the Kintyre peninsula, from which it is separated by the 2-3 mile wide Firth of Gigha. Access to Gigha is via a frequent car ferry from Tayinloan on the Kintyre coast, which itself is roughly mid way between …

WebThe Gigha ferry departs from Tayinloan on the west coast of the Kintyre peninsula. The journey takes 20 minutes. No advance booking is necessary on these sailings. Simply turn up at the port of departure and go on the next available sailing. Tayinloan is roughly 120 miles from Glasgow.
